Description

17Beta-Hydroxy-17-(3-Hydroxy-1-Propynyl)Androst-4-Ene-3-One is a high-purity steroid derivative, serving as a critical advanced intermediate in pharmaceutical synthesis. Its value lies in enabling the production of potent and selective therapeutic agents, particularly in the field of endocrinology. This compound is essential for research institutions and pharmaceutical manufacturers developing next-generation hormone therapies and performance-enhancing drugs.

Application

  • Pharmaceutical Intermediate: A key building block in the synthesis of anabolic-androgenic steroids (AAS) and other specialized hormonal agents.
  • Research & Development: Used in academic and industrial laboratories for studying steroid receptor activity, metabolism, and structure-activity relationships (SAR).
  • Reference Standard: Serves as a certified reference material (CRM) for quality control and analytical method development in pharmaceutical analysis.
  • Precursor for Derivatives: Utilized for the chemical modification and creation of novel steroid analogs with tailored biological properties.

Basic Information

Product Name 17Beta-Hydroxy-17-(3-Hydroxy-1-Propynyl)Androst-4-Ene-3-One
CAS No. 55542-26-2
Molecular Formula C22H30O3
Molecular Weight 342.48 g/mol
Synonyms 17β-Hydroxy-17-(3-hydroxyprop-1-yn-1-yl)androst-4-en-3-one; 17β-Hydroxy-17-(3-hydroxy-1-propynyl)-4-androsten-3-one; 17β-Hydroxy-17-(3-hydroxypropynyl)androst-4-ene-3-one; 17β-Hydroxy-17-(3-hydroxy-1-propynyl)androst-4-ene-3-one; 4-Androsten-3-one, 17β-hydroxy-17-(3-hydroxy-1-propynyl)-; 17β-Hydroxy-17-(3-hydroxyprop-1-ynyl)-4-androsten-3-one; 17β-Hydroxy-17-(3-hydroxyprop-1-ynyl)androst-4-en-3-one

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ed in a dry environment to prevent degradation.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to reference spectrum
Purity (HPLC) ≥ 98.0%
Loss on Drying ≤ 1.0%
Residue on Ignition ≤ 0.1%
Single Unknown Impurity (HPLC) ≤ 0.5%
Total Impurities (HPLC) ≤ 2.0%
